        Villanova Wildcats at Georgetown Hoyas [ESPN | 12:00 PM ET]

        Wildcats: Villanova has more than earned their loftly #2 national ranking this season. Villanova is an impressive 20-1 SU this season, with only a loss at Temple keeping them from perfection. The Wildcats are playing their best basketball of the season in league play, as they are 9-0 SU. Villanova is 15-5 ATS this season, with all but 1 of their games coming as the listed favorite. Today will mark only the 2nd game this season that Villanova is the listed underdog. The Wildcats are 10-1 SU and 8-3 ATS in both true road games and neutral court games this season. Villanova has a prolific offense, as they've scored more than 80 PTS in 6 straight games. 9 of the 20 games Villanova has played, they've scored 90 PTS or more. 6 different players averaged double digit in PTS, led by star G Scottie Reynolds. Reynolds averages 18.5 PPG, including 2 made 3 pointers per game. Reynolds had 27 PTS against Georgetown 3 weeks ago in an 82-77 win.

        Villanova is 5-0 ATS last 5 road games.
        Over is 7-1 last 8 road games.

        Key Injuries - None.

        PROJECTED SCORE: 80 (OVER - Total of the Day)

        Hoyas (-2, O/U 151): Georgetown has been on a roller coaster ride the past 3 games, reaching the ultimate in highs and the lowest of lows in an 11 day span. The Hoyas lost SU by 17 PTS to Syracuse, then followed that loss up with a thrashing of Duke 89-77. In their latest game, the Hoyas lost SU to South Florida 64-72 as -12.5 favorites. The Hoyas are 16-5 SU on the season, earning themselves a #7 national ranking. The Hoyas are 10-2 SU and 5-4 ATS at home this season. Georgetown is 4-2 ATS as a single digit favorite this season. The Hoyas have yet to win more than 2 games in a row ATS this season. Georgetown is 3-1 ATS coming off a SU loss in their previous game this season. All 5 Hoyas starters average at least 8 PPG this season. G Austin Freeman and C Greg Monroe pace the Hoyas, combining for nearly 32 PPG, 13.5 RPG, and 5.5 APG this season. The Hoyas have allowed an average of nearly 74 PPG over their past 3 contests.

        Georgetown is 7-21 ATS last 28 vs. Big East.
        Over is 5-0 last 5 games following a SU loss.

        Key Injuries - F Nikita Mescheriakov (personal) is out.

        PROJECTED SCORE: 78



        Texas Longhorns at Oklahoma Sooners [ESPN | 4:00 PM ET]

        Longhorns (-6.5, O/U 148): Texas is still ranked in the Top 10 in the country, despite losing 3 of their past 5 games SU. Texas started the season 17-0 SU, before their recent struggles. The Longhorns have enjoyed recent success against Oklahoma, having won 7 of the past 8 meetings SU between the two. The Longhorns are 7-2 SU and 4-5 ATS in both true road games and neutral court games. Texas is 4-3 ATS as a single digit favorite this season. Despite their overall success this season, the Longhorns have only won once ATS in their past 9 games. Texas has scored 72 PTS or more in 19 of their 21 games this season. Texas averages nearly 85 PPG this season, with F Damion James leading the way with 18 PPG. James also leads Texas in rebounding, averaging 11 RPG. G Jordan Hamilton averages 9.3 PPG this season, but is coming off his best performance of the season. Hamilton scored 27 PTS in beating Oklahoma St on the road.

        Longhorns are 2-10-1 ATS last 13 road games vs. a team with a winning home record.
        Over is 16-7 last 23 games following a SU win.

        Key Injuries - G Shawn Williams (ankle) is out.
        G Varez Ward (knee) is out.

        PROJECTED SCORE: 74

        Sooners: Oklahoma has lost 3 of their past 4 games SU, with all 3 being league games away from home. Oklahoma is a completely different team at home, as they are 10-0 SU this season. The Sooners have won 31 of their past 32 home games SU, so clearly this team enjoys a true home court advantage. The Sooners are 12-9 SU and 7-11 ATS for the season, and stands at 3-4 SU in conference play this season. The Sooners are 4-3 ATS at home this season, with today marking only the 2nd time this season Oklahoma will be the listed underdog at home. The Sooners are 3-4 ATS as the listed underdog so far this season, with 2 wins SU in that specific span. 4 Sooners average double digits for Oklahoma, with G Willie Warren leading the way with 16.8 PPG. Guards Tommy Mason-Griffin and Tony Crocker combine to average 24.5 PPG, with nearly 4 three pointers made per game combined. The Sooners have held 4 of their past 6 opponents to 65 PTS of fewer.

        Sooners are 9-4 ATS last 13 home games vs. a team with a winning road record.
        Over is 6-1 last 7 home games vs. a team with a winning road record.

        Key Injuries - None.

        PROJECTED SCORE: 73 (Side of the Day)

          Information on the best of Saturday's college basketball games........


          Providence lost four of last five games, skid that started with 93-63 loss to Marquette (+9) three weeks ago; Eagles shot 61% from floor, made 13-21 treys in game. Friars are 2-2 at home in Big East, beating Rutgers and UConn, losing to Louisville, So Florida- they're 3-4 as Big East dog. Marquette is 1-4 on Big East road (games decided by 1-2-1-5-2 pts).

          Villanova (-6) beat Georgetown 82-77 Jan 17, game they led by 15 at the half; Hoyas shot just 39% for game. Wildcats are 9-0 in Big East; only one of their four road wins is by less than 8 points- they're 1-0 as a dog this season. Hoyas beat Duke last Saturday, then lost to South Florida during week, their first loss in five Big East home games.

          Xavier (-5) beat Dayton 78-74 Jan 16 after trailing by 3 at half; they hit 10-19 from arc in game, blocked 10 Flyer shots in holding them to 37% from floor. Dayton is 0-3 in A-14 games decided by less than six points; they're 2-1 at home in A-14, 1-2 as home favorite. Xavier won, covered its last four games; favorites are 8-1 vs spread in their A-14 games.

          Virginia (+5.5) was down 34-15 at half in 69-57 loss at Wake Forest Jan 23 that was Cavs' first in ACC after three wins; UVa shot 34% for game, was outscored 20-8 on foul line- they're 3-1 as ACC home favorite, with home wins by 7-18-12 points. Wake won three of last four games; they are 2-2 as ACC road dog, losing away games by 1-20-21 points.

          Mississippi State beat Florida last two years, by 9-9 points; Gators lost two of last three visits here. Bulldogs lost three of last four games, losing last three road games by 5-5-3 points- dogs covered five of their seven SEC games. Florida won five of last six games, with three of its last four decided by 1 or 2 points. Gators won last three at home by 14-2-16.

          Richmond won last three games by 5-26-10 points, allowing 50.3 ppg-- they're 1-3 as Atlantic 14 home favorite, winning at home by 7-4-26 pts with a loss to Charlotte. Temple won eight of last nine games since loss at Kansas Jan 2; Owls are 4-2 vs spread as a dog this year, 1-1 in A-14. Home team is 6-2 vs spread in Temple's A-14 games this season.

          Gonzaga crushed WCC rival Portland late Thursday; they're making 4th trip east of Mississippi this year (they also took Maui trip). Bulldogs are 4-1 vs spread as an underdog. Memphis is 3-2 in last five games, 3-1 vs spread in last four home games. C-USA home favorites are 23-15 vs spread in non-conference games. WCC road underdogs are 16-22.

          Not only did Old Dominion lose to VCU in CAA semis LY, Monarchs lost five of last six visits here, losing by 17-6-5-4-6 pointd. ODU is 9-1 in last 10 games overall, losing last road game at Northeastern- they are 4-2 on CAA, also losing to Mason. Rams won three in row, seven of last eight games- they're 3-3 as home favorite, winning by 34-13-22-49-16.

          Underdog covered last eight Clemson-Virginia Tech games; Tigers won four of last five series games, winning last three visits here, as road team won five of last six in series. Hokies held off North Carolina Thursday; they're 3-0 at home in ACC this year, winning by 15-1-4 points. Tigers are 1-3 on ACC road, winning at NC State, losing by 21-2-6 points.

          UCLA won four of last five games; they upset Cal 76-75 (+15) Jan 6, in game where Cal made just 2-18 from arc (UCLA was 9-20). UCLA won four of six Pac-10 home games, losing to Arizona/USC, winning by 2-1-12-4 points-- underdogs are 7-3 vs spread in their Pac-10 games. Cal lost its last two games; they're 2-3 on Pac-10 road, beating Wazzu, ASU.

          Texas won seven of last eight games vs Oklahoma, with favorites 4-0 vs spread in last four; they split last six visits to Norman. Longhorns split last four games overall, are 1-5 vs spread as Big 12 favorite- they're 1-1 as road favorite, winning by 7 at Iowa State, Oklahoma St by 12. OU is 1-3 in last four games- home team won all seven of their Big 12 games.

          Baylor lost four of last five visits to Texas A&M, with only win in five OTs two years ago; underdog is 11-1 vs spread in last 12 series games. Bears covered four of last five games; they're 2-0 as Big 12 dog, but 1-2 SU on SEC road, losing by 7 at Colorado, 6 at Kansasw. Aggies won last five games; they're 4-0 at home, winning by 11-3-4-15 points.

          UNLV (+8) lost 77-73 at BYU in MWC opener Jan 6, getting outscored 19-8 from foul line; BYU also had 16 offensive rebounds. Rebels are 6-1 since that game, winning last four by 8-9-10-28 points- they're 4-2 as a MWC home favorite. BYU's only league loss was 76-72 at New Mexico; their win vs UNLV was just their second in last seven series games.

          Tennessee won last five games vs South Carolina, scoring 80+ points in all five; Vols are 2-5 vs spread in SEC play, 1-3 as home favorite, with home wins by 26-2-1, and a loss to Vandy. South Carolina won last two games (by 6-1) behind Downey's heroics; Gamecocks lost last six visits to Knoxville by 7-8-16-3-33-3 points (2-4 against the spread).

          Pitt had 20 turnovers, shot 35% from floor, 4-17 from arc in 64-61 loss (+3.5) at Seton Hall Jan 24; Panthers lost four of last five games, are 3-1 as Big East home favorite, winning by 13-5-10 points, with only loss to Georgetown. Pirates are 0-4 on Big East road, losing by 8-12-2-10; they are 1-4 vs spread as Big East dog, 1-2 on the road.

          Troy shot 54.4% from floor, 7-16 from arc in 77-69 win vs Hilltoppers Jan 21; Western Kentucky has now lost six of last seven games- they're 3-3 as Sun Belt home favorite, winning by 12-7-17-20, losing to both Middle Tennessee/North Texas. Troy won last three games, but they're 1-3 as Sun Belt road dog, losing away games by 14-2-15 pts (3-3 SU).

          Arizona is 9-1 vs spread in Pac-10, covering last seven; they're 6-0 as a Pac-10 road dog, splitting six road games SU. Wildcats lost 78-76 (-2) at home to Washington State Jan 8; Coogs shot 51% from floor that night. Wazzu lost laast three games (by 12-28-11 points); they're 1-6 against spread in last seven, and is just 2-3 at home in Pac-10 play.

          Illinois is 7-3 in Big 11, 4-1 at home, losing by 6 to Purdue; they're 2-2 as Big 11 underdog. Michigan State held Illinois to 35% from floor, 6-25 from arc in 73-63 win Jan 16 (-11.5); Spartan PG Lucas sprained ankle in last game, is doubtful here, as Spartans try to bounce back from first Big 11 loss of season- they're 1-5 vs spread in their last six games.

          Texas-El Paso won its last six games, but they're 0-4 as C-USA favorite at home, winning home games by 4-7-13-7 points- road team is 7-1 vs spread in its league games. Tulsa is 7-1 in C-USA, losing at UAB by 10 points; they've won last four games vs UTEP, but are 0-4 vs spread in last four games overall. Golden Hurricane is 1-1 as an underdog in 2010.

          Washington won its last four Pac-10 home games by 33-15-28-6 points, even though they've gotten to line 29 less times than foes in those four games- Huskies are 3-3 as Pac-10 home favorite. Arizona State beat the Huskies 68-51 in first meeting, outscoring U-Dub 30-12 from foul line. Sun Devils won last three road games, six of last eight games overall.
